Lyndhurst Early Learning Centre History

 

An exciting new era in early childhood learning begins in Spring 2008 ...

Children First Learning Centres have begun redevelopment of the historic Hall & Dodd's designed building in the grounds of Clayfield College, the first step in transforming the heritage listed building into the area's leading Early Learning facility.

Set on a spacious 3000 square metre site, the centre will offer programs for children from 6 weeks old to 5 years old. The centre will operate Monday to Friday, 52 weeks per year, 6.30am to 6.30pm, providing a nurturning and child centric learning environment. The focus will be on developing a strong learning basis for children at the most influential time of their lives.

Being located in the grounds of Clayfield College provides a level of convenience for busy working parents. We look forward to inviting the community to inspect Lyndhurst at a number of planned open days prior to when we open in late spring.
